Runbook: Ferrowick ORM migration. The legacy layer (mapper/*.py) and the new Keel adapters run side by side; reads go through Keel, writes still hit both. If write divergence alerts fire, pause the comparison job, capture the diff report, and page the data platform rotation — do not disable dual-write yourself. Schema changes must land in the legacy layer first or Keel's codegen breaks. Current cutover status and the per-table checklist are kept on the migration page.

runbook for badug-kadup: https://confluence.zemvarlabs.internal/projects/browse/display/projects/bd1b

Facilities ticket — Halewick Tower, night shift.

Issue: support team reporting east stairwell reader rejecting badges after midnight. Reader was reset this morning; firmware updated. Overnight crew should now badge as normal. If the reader fails again, use the manual keypad by the fire door — do not prop the door. Log any further failures with the time and badge name. Temporary keypad code for the fallback door is below.

door code, tajeg-fawip: bdg-K-62

## Formula sandbox tuning

User-supplied formulas in Gridmoor execute inside a restricted interpreter with hard ceilings on time, memory, and call depth. Reviewers should confirm any change to these ceilings is justified in the PR description, since raising them widens the abuse surface. Defaults were chosen from production traces. The current limits are as follows.

limits module of tafog-fawip:
WEIGHTS = {
    "julix": 57,
    "lamys": 992,
    "kasvan": 209,
    "quenok": 750,
    "alddor": 259,
    "oliath": 1009,
    "wenix": 815,
}

## Authentication

If your plugin hooks into the StockSquare reconciliation job, it needs to call our internal ledger service, and that means bringing a key along. Plugins without one get rejected before the first batch runs, no exceptions. Pop it into your plugin config under the auth section. The key to use is below.

app token of hahig-yawip = zpat11_7vvKNZ1kAOl